社区
Delphi
帖子详情
Bitmap怎样设置点阵的存储大小
lyrzhlgq
2003-08-23 04:14:15
众位大虾在设置Bitmap大小的时候我是这样设置的
Bitmap := TBitmap.Create;
Bitmap.width := 5000;
Bitmap.height := 5000;
可是这样,就无法通过,好像是内存不够.是不是可以设置默认的点的存储大小.好像应该可以设置Bitmap的每个点的存储大小,比如可以将每个点变成两位色,不就站的少了么.可是我不知道怎么设呀.
拜托,另外Save框怎么做呀,用什么命令.
...全文
68
5
打赏
收藏
Bitmap怎样设置点阵的存储大小
众位大虾在设置Bitmap大小的时候我是这样设置的 Bitmap := TBitmap.Create; Bitmap.width := 5000; Bitmap.height := 5000; 可是这样,就无法通过,好像是内存不够.是不是可以设置默认的点的存储大小.好像应该可以设置Bitmap的每个点的存储大小,比如可以将每个点变成两位色,不就站的少了么.可是我不知道怎么设呀. 拜托,另外Save框怎么做呀,用什么命令.
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
iceboy1979
2003-08-23
打赏
举报
回复
好像是Pixelformat属性
Bitmap.Pixelformat := 1;
你可以试试
zorrohong
2003-08-23
打赏
举报
回复
procedure TForm1.Button1Click(Sender: TObject);
var
BitMap1,BitMap2 : TBitMap;
MyFormat : Word;
begin
BitMap2 := TBitMap.Create;
BitMap1 := TBitMap.Create;
try
BitMap1.LoadFromFile('c:\Program Files\common Files\Borland Shared\Images\Splash\256color\factory.bmp');
BitMap2.Assign(BitMap1); // Copy BitMap1 into BitMap2
BitMap2.Dormant; // Free up GDI resources
BitMap2.FreeImage; // Free up Memory.
Canvas.Draw(20,20,BitMap2); // Note that previous calls don't lose the image
BitMap2.Monochrome := true;
Canvas.Draw(80,80,BitMap2);
BitMap2.ReleaseHandle; // This will actually lose the bitmap;
finally
BitMap1.Free;
BitMap2.Free;
end;
end;
帮助里的代码.
zorrohong
2003-08-23
打赏
举报
回复
bitmap.monochrome ->确定位图是否按单色显示图像.
sy_315
2003-08-23
打赏
举报
回复
email:sy_315@163.com
sy_315
2003-08-23
打赏
举报
回复
哥们建议你把bmp转成jpeg格式的
我现在有bmp转jpeg的例子,并且存储到数据库中
计算机辅助设计教案一photoshop(共77张PPT).pptx
二、位图和矢量图: 位图(
Bitmap
): 位图又称为
点阵
图、像素图或栅格图像,是由称作像素(栅格)的单个点组成。这些点可以进行不同的排列和染色以构成图样。 位图的单位:像素(Pixel); 像素(Pixel):指可以...
flash shiti
FLASH 样题参考答案 1.D 2.D 3.C 4.B 5.B 6.A 7.D 8.B 9.D 10.B 11.B 12.C 13.A 14.D 15.D 16.A 17.A 18.D 19.B 20.A 21.C 22.A 23.C 24.C 25.C 26.D 27.C 28.C 29.D 30.C 31.B 32.A 33.ABCD 34.ACD 35.CD 36....
android开发从入门到项目
1、课程采用Android Studio【以后简称as】开发,需要有java基础的同学才能看 需要设备电脑推荐 win10 + 手机推荐小米8 2、课程内容围绕着以下五点来讲四大组件(服务、广播、ContentProvider、页面容器)基础UI组件(ListView、ViewPager)异步任务机制(AsyncTask、Handler、线程池)布局优化(层级、绘制、碎片化处理)图片加载(
Bitmap
、缓冲区)3、项目的管理 git工具的使用 4、做项目,通过项目来提升自己 第一个项目【计算器】 5、做项目,第二个新项目【短信接收发送】写一个查话费的小软件
字体是用
点阵
图
存储
还是用矢量图
存储
?
字体可以用
点阵
图(
Bitmap
Fonts)或矢量图(Vector Fonts)来
存储
,两者各有优缺点。
BITMAP
位图原理与简单读取
Bitmap
(位图,缩写BMP,又称栅格图 “Raster graphics”)或
点阵
图,是使用
点阵
来表示的图像格式。 通常来说是无压缩的图片格式,通常保存的颜色深度有 2(1 位)、16(4 位)、256(8 位)、65536(16 位)、1670 ...
Delphi
5,388
社区成员
262,730
社区内容
发帖
与我相关
我的任务
Delphi
Delphi 开发及应用
复制链接
扫一扫
分享
社区描述
Delphi 开发及应用
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章